Searched defs:interchange (Results 1 – 3 of 3) sorted by relevance
/llvm-project/mlir/test/lib/Interfaces/TilingInterface/ |
H A D | TestTilingInterfaceTransformOps.cpp | 61 ArrayRef<int64_t> interchange, bool useForall, in applyTileAndFuseToAll() argument 225 applyTileToAll(RewriterBase & rewriter,Operation * transformOp,Range && payloadOps,ArrayRef<OpFoldResult> tileSizes,ArrayRef<int64_t> interchange,std::optional<ArrayAttr> mapping,TransformResults & transformResults) applyTileToAll() argument 273 SmallVector<int64_t> interchange = apply() local
|
/llvm-project/mlir/lib/Dialect/Utils/ |
H A D | IndexingUtils.cpp | 222 bool mlir::isPermutationVector(ArrayRef<int64_t> interchange) { in isPermutationVector() argument
|
/llvm-project/mlir/lib/Dialect/Linalg/TransformOps/ |
H A D | LinalgTransformOps.cpp | 2825 build(OpBuilder & builder,OperationState & result,TypeRange loopTypes,Value target,ArrayRef<int64_t> staticTileSizes,ArrayRef<int64_t> interchange,std::optional<ArrayRef<bool>> scalableSizes) build() argument 2836 build(OpBuilder & builder,OperationState & result,Value target,ArrayRef<int64_t> staticTileSizes,ArrayRef<int64_t> interchange,std::optional<ArrayRef<bool>> scalableSizes) build() argument 2845 build(OpBuilder & builder,OperationState & result,Value target,ArrayRef<OpFoldResult> mixedTileSizes,ArrayRef<int64_t> interchange,std::optional<ArrayRef<bool>> scalableSizes) build() argument 2857 build(OpBuilder & builder,OperationState & result,TypeRange loopTypes,Value target,ArrayRef<OpFoldResult> mixedTileSizes,ArrayRef<int64_t> interchange,std::optional<ArrayRef<bool>> scalableSizes) build() argument [all...] |